    Just wanted to do a little heads up for any DCi 175 or DCi engined megane owners.

    Ive had a niggle for some time now, Ive been experiencing a bit of lag on the old turbo and the new hybrid. The brakes have also felt a bit vague, if you know that feeling of an unfamiliar car when you step on the brakes and you can feel the assistance and sharpness. Well i was missing this feel to the brakes.

    I traced it back to the Vacuum pump, even though id tested this a few times but hadnt had any signs or drop in vac pressure. the turbo actuator was opening fully and the brake booster testing was fine.

    These type of pump run off the cam so are under a lot of pressure to perform, they create the vacuum as a diesel cant create it via the engine alone. if they have a slight leak they wont suck as hard :wink:

    So i took the plunge and replaced the vacuum pump. Fairly easy job to do its 3 10mm bolts, you just have to moved the battery and ecu and a few fuel lines out the way.

    Well worth it for the sake of a second hand unit around £30 new are about £180 inc delivery, but im happy with the second hand one for now.

    Had a bit of a giveaway oil slick that the old vac pump had been leaking. if theyre not air tight they wont perform to standard.
